About N-[phenyl-[(3-triphenylsilylcarbazol-9-yl)methylideneamino]methylidene]benzenecarboximidamide

N-[phenyl-[(3-triphenylsilylcarbazol-9-yl)methylideneamino]methylidene]benzenecarboximidamide (PubChem CID 169044297) has the molecular formula C45H34N4Si and a molecular weight of 658.88 g/mol. Its IUPAC name is N-[phenyl-[(3-triphenylsilylcarbazol-9-yl)methylideneamino]methylidene]benzenecarboximidamide.
